Unless you book a flydrive package you can't get the flights yet from Virgin, there are several charter companies booking that far ahead so they may be worth a look.
Other than that just wait a wee while, all schedule flight onlys will come on sale this october

We always book as soon as the flights are released, 11 months before the date of our return leg :)

We seem to get a good(ish) price then, but if you have the nerve sometimes it can pay to hold on and see if you can grab a last minute bargain. Personally, I have never had the nerve to do this but I know others have done this and paid a lot less for their flights :thumbsup2 (Bear in mind you may need to be a bit more flexible if you take this approach).
